Daily Wisdom: James 3:10-11 (KJV)

Sunday, August 13, 2006

Out of the same mouth proceedeth blessing and cursing. My brethren, these things ought not so to be. Doth a fountain send forth at the same place sweet water and bitter?
— James 3:10-11 (KJV)
